Gerald “Jeri” F. Santy, 77, beloved father, grandfather, brother, uncle and friend, transitioned from this life peacefully on May 5, 2025 at his daughter Cher Santy’s home with his son, Chadwick Santy, and daughter Cher at his bedside.

Gerald was born on Jan. 25, 1948, in Laconia, the son of the late Gerald B. Santy and Eleanor T. (Trottier) Santy.

After graduating from Belmont High School, Jeri attended Belknap College in Center Harbor.

Jeri had a lifelong career in all aspects of construction, including “roof to the road” knowledge. With the construction knowledge he had obtained, he decided to move to Charleston, South Carolina, to assist in the rebuilding process after Hurricane Hugo on Sept. 21, 1989.

Gerald had a flair for life. He talked about his faith in God daily, loved playing baseball, golf (his favorite), fishing, hunting, traveling throughout the United States, visiting in New Hampshire to see all his loved ones, friends and family, loved his dogs and cats. He even made a TV commercial in Charleston, South Carolina, for a company called “Gerald’s Tire & Brakes, LLC.” He was so excited to be on TV regularly. There was never a moment in his life where he would not stop people to say hello and shake their hands just to be friendly. He loved everyone.
